Science & Tech Quote by Sidney Altman

"My intention was to enroll at McGill University but an unexpected series of events led me to study physics at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ology"

About this Quote

The charm here is in the mismatch between “intention” and outcome: a neat, almost bureaucratic plan (“enroll at McGill”) gets quietly steamrolled by contingency (“an unexpected series of events”). Altman, a scientist whose career would hinge on noticing what others missed, frames his origin story the way lab work often feels: you set up a hypothesis, then reality barges in with better data.

The sentence is studiously plain, which is the point. There’s no romantic mythology about destiny, no chest-thumping about ambition. Instead, the subtext is that prestige and trajectory are often retrofitted after the fact. MIT appears not as a trophy but as a byproduct of turbulence - an institution that functions here as shorthand for a certain intensity of training and a certain kind of intellectual permission. The phrase “unexpected series of events” is doing heavy lifting: it withholds the melodrama while insisting that lives, even accomplished ones, are routed through accidents, migrations, finances, mentors, politics - forces that rarely make it into Nobel citations.

Context matters: for a 20th-century North American scientist, the move from a strong Canadian university to an American research powerhouse tracks with the era’s gravitational pull toward U.S. funding and labs. The line reads like a modest correction to the heroic narrative of science. Not “I chose greatness,” but “I followed the vector.” In that restraint is a subtle argument about how discovery actually happens: not by pure will, but by being re-positioned, then staying curious enough to take advantage of it.
